Cuba with a 4yr old a 1 yr old and my sis 9m old! Is it going to be a nightmare?

We are off to Cuba in April. We will be staying on the Cayo Islands. We have concerns about the milk being pasturised, being able to use water, food etc etc...
Has anyone been to Cuba with their small children and how did they find it?

I took my DS a year ago-he was 1. We stayed in Varadero and it was the worst holiday ever as the wee fella was ill for 11 days out of the 14 with chronic diarrohea. Had to get the doctor out to the room and he was taken to hospital in the end as he was dehydrated. The hospital was just as you would imagine in a poor country. There was no milk to buy in the supermarket-only coffee mate???
I would just check there are adequate medical facilities before you go as you never know. Sorry to be the voice of doom but just giving an honest opinion.
On a positive note, the cubans are amazing people and Havana is a special place.

I have been to Cuba a few times, once with ds when he was about 4.

Yes, it is a poor country and yes, problems with supplies, but Cuba has some of the worlds best trained doctors and child health is better than in many developed countries. It's more about being careful, as you might be anywhere with small children, making sure fruit is washed properly, bottles sterilised and food well cooked.

The cubans are amongst the most friendly people anywhere in the world and would do anything for children. As long as you take plenty of milk powder and sterilising tablets and a firt aid kit with calpol, rehydration sachets etc just to be safe, I'm sure you'll have a fabulous time.
